Dhursunda

Dhursunda is a village located in Bharatpur Ii subdivision of Murshidabad district in West Bengal, India. Berhampore and Salar are the district & sub-district headquarters of Dhursunda village respectively. As per 2009 stats, Salu is the gram panchayat of Dhursunda village.

About Dhursunda

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Dhursunda is 315701. The village spans a total geographical area of 83.22 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 742401. Kandi is nearest town to Dhursunda village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 32km away.

Population of Dhursunda

According to the 2011 Census, Dhursunda has a total population of about 927, with approximately 471 males and 456 females. The sex ratio is around 968 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 145 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 29 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 57.82%, with male literacy at about 62.85% and female literacy near 52.63%. There are around 194 households in the village. Connectivity of Dhursunda

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Dhursunda. As per the 2011 stats, Dhursunda had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Railway Station Available within 5 - 10 km distance
